Timeplanner and Norwood Reach Agreement

Timeplanner Calendars/Journalbooks, Charlotte, N.C., and Norwood, Indianapolis, have reached an agreement to settle the legal action filed by Timeplanner against Norwood. Timeplanner sought remedies for Norwood’s use of the trademark TIMEPLANNER®, a federally registered trademark of Timeplanner, in its current product catalog. Pursuant to the settlement, Norwood agreed to cease using Timeplanner’s trademark. In addition, Norwood has agreed to take steps to clarify in any of its existing materials that TIMEPLANNER® is a trademark owned by Timeplanner and not to use the trademark in any future materials. Alcraft Releases Seasonal Catalog

Alcraft, Pawtucket, R.I., recently released a 32-page holiday catalog filled with more than 200 products, 60 of which are new.
